Posts by month
October 2020
3 posts
Springboot常用依赖/工具包
一.前端部分 1.bootstrap+jquery 引用链接: 2.常用前端组件下载:1.layer.js (弹窗组件)2.fileinput (文件上传组件) 3.thymeleaf名字空间 二.后端部分 1.热部署 application.properties添加语句:spring.thymeleaf.cache=false 2.WebSocket 使用案例见:https://www.fullstar.tech/427/ 3.shiro 使用案例见:https://www.fullstar.tech/934/
Share
SpringBoot+WebSocket
1.导入依赖 2.后端 2.1 配置类(config) 2.2 WebSocketServer类 解释:设置@ServerEndpoint(“/socket/{wid}”),其作用类似于controller中常用的@RequestMapping注解,当前端访问此地址时将访问函数@OnOpen 3.前端 4.后端发送 5.利用websocket实现伪单点登录 用户在每个前端页面均与后端保持websocket连接,其中连接使用账号充当key,当有相同账号的用户登录时查看哈希表中是否存在相同key值,若有则表示重复登录,则后端向前端发送信息,通知其退出登录,在其退出登录后第二个用户再建立连接。
Share